1. Measure the Door

The first step in replacing the handle made of composite door glass replacement on the door is to determine its exact size. The easiest method to determine this is by measuring the handle that is currently in use. The measurements you need to determine are the center of the spindle hole (also known as the PZ measurement) and the centers of the Euro holes in the cylinders.

Once you have the measurements, you can begin shopping for a handle. There are a variety of handles to choose from It's essential to take your time to find one that suits your style and your home. The choice of the perfect door handle isn't just about looks, it's also about functionality and security.

When shopping for a new door handle, be sure that you measure the door and not the brick opening. This will help you obtain a more precise handle size and ensure that it fits properly. You should also be aware of the backset of your door. This is the distance from the middle of a handle bore hole to the edge of the door. Most uPVC doors have either 2-3/8" or 2-3/4" backsets Be sure to select a handle with the right backset for your door.

There are many methods to measure a door handle. The most common way is to use the aid of a tape measure. Use a measuring tape that is calibrated to get the most effective results. It is important to keep in mind that measurements are measured in millimetres.

Once you've made the measurement, you'll need to decide whether you want to replace only the handle or the entire handle set. The replacement lock for composite door of the handle set is generally a much simpler process and can save you money in the long run.

Install the new handle after you have removed the old handle. The process is simple and the final result should be perfect. Be careful not to loose any screw, and make sure that all components are properly aligned. It's a great idea to test the new handle by moving it up and down, and locking and unlocking.

2. Remove the handle that was previously used

The door handle is an important element of a door that can add style and functionality. If they are broken or old, or deteriorated, replacing them is a straightforward and simple project that will make a a big difference to the appearance of your home. But, before you install a new handle, it is essential to take out the old one, and ensure that the holes left behind are large enough for the replacement to be able to fit.

It is easy to remove the mounting screws on the majority of door handles. Some designs are harder to remove. If you are looking for these, look for the small slot or recessed fastener in the handle's neck usually near the point where the base joins to the latch plate. You can pull the handle off using an screwdriver, or a tiny Allen wrench. When you do this, be cautious as the handle and latch plate could fall out of the door. If this happens, take two pieces of half-circle cardboard (not box cardboard, but not construction paper either) and tuck them into the holes that you made when you took out the bolts. This will prevent the latch and handle plates from falling to the bottom of your door.

If the handle isn't screwed onto the lock, it could be held in place by pins. It could also be able to snap into a hole in the lock mechanism. In this scenario, you will have to first remove the entire cover plate or rose, and then the handle. Some handles have a screw holding the latch plate, which can be unscrewed.

When you have removed the handle that was previously used, you should find a set of holes in the door slab, that are exactly the same size as the latch plate that is set in the door jamb. Make sure you choose the replacement handle that has the same size of latch plate to avoid having to redo this step. Make sure the strike plate is inserted inside the door jamb in order to hold the latch in place when the door is closed.

3. Install the new Handle

The handle on the door is a crucial element of the front door as it allows you to enter your home and provides security for your family and you. If the handle starts to lose its shine, or becomes difficult for you to operate, then it's time to replace it. It is simple to replace your door handle, whether for aesthetic reasons or because it was damaged. You don't need a professional to do it.

Use a door stopper, or whatever else you have in your home to keep the door open during your work. This will stop the door from closing behind you as you try to install your new handles. It will also make the process easier.

Once you have secured the door open, you'll need to loosen the screws that hold the current knob in place. They are usually located on the side of the door, and may be covered with a cover plate for aesthetic purposes. When the screws are loose, take out the handle that was previously in use and ensure that the holes in the door are clear. The spindle of the new handle must be inserted in the hole to allow it to be visible on the other side.

Make sure that the screw holes on the handle match the screwholes on the door, and that it is positioned in the correct direction. If the handle is a lever, this will need to be fitted with the open end facing the hinges on the door, or if it is a doorknob, it must be fitted with the closed end facing away from them.

You'll also have to decide on the right composite door handle replacement. The most commonly used handle is one that has two holes on either side, and can be used on both left and right-handed doors. You'll need to determine the distance from the edge of the door to the center of the knob opening, which is called the backset, and ensure that the new handle you choose to purchase will fit this measurement.
